View of the estate of Nieuwland, De Heerlykheyt van Nieu Land (title on object), View of the village and the estate of Nieuwland on Walcheren, from a bird's-eye perspective. Top left putti with the coat of arms of Nieuwland. At the top center a map of the glory and the title. Top right the coat of arms of Catharina Verbrugge - the widow of Cornelis Claesz. van Elfsdijk - who had bought the manor in 1679., print, print maker: Jan Luyken, publisher: Johannes Meertens, (possibly), publisher: Abraham van Someren, (possibly), print maker: Amsterdam, publisher: Middelburg, publisher: Amsterdam, publisher: Leiden, 1696 - 1728, paper, etching, engraving, height, 263 mm × width, 332 mm
